Indian Railway Catering & Tourism Corporation Limited (BOM:542830)
India flag India · Delayed Price · Currency is INR
718.65
-8.50 (-1.17%)
At close: Aug 8, 2025

Paramount Global Ratios and Metrics

Millions INR.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 20212016 - 2020
Period Ending
Aug '25 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21 2016 - 2020
575,160582,000743,760458,240619,760281,120
Upgrade
Market Cap Growth
-21.75%-21.75%62.31%-26.06%120.46%78.82%
Upgrade
Enterprise Value
553,361558,218724,164441,025600,169264,501
Upgrade
Last Close Price
718.65727.20917.57561.56753.31340.30
Upgrade
PE Ratio
43.7444.2666.9445.5693.97150.31
Upgrade
PS Ratio
12.3012.4517.4612.9432.9936.20
Upgrade
PB Ratio
15.7015.8923.0318.4933.1419.31
Upgrade
P/TBV Ratio
15.7115.9023.0518.5133.2319.40
Upgrade
P/FCF Ratio
76.2477.14115.7579.96131.35178.76
Upgrade
P/OCF Ratio
69.0269.8484.3156.45118.28113.57
Upgrade
EV/Sales Ratio
11.8411.9417.0012.4531.9534.06
Upgrade
EV/EBITDA Ratio
35.7136.6250.4035.2770.66157.73
Upgrade
EV/EBIT Ratio
36.9437.2651.4036.0772.86185.39
Upgrade
EV/FCF Ratio
73.3573.99112.7076.95127.19168.19
Upgrade
Debt / Equity Ratio
0.030.030.020.030.060.06
Upgrade
Debt / EBITDA Ratio
0.060.060.040.070.120.43
Upgrade
Debt / FCF Ratio
0.120.120.090.150.220.51
Upgrade
Asset Turnover
0.730.730.760.790.530.24
Upgrade
Inventory Turnover
262.23262.23254.35239.78123.5060.79
Upgrade
Quick Ratio
1.571.571.521.391.381.38
Upgrade
Current Ratio
2.032.031.961.821.881.76
Upgrade
Return on Equity (ROE)
38.15%38.15%38.93%46.26%39.66%13.51%
Upgrade
Return on Assets (ROA)
14.53%14.53%15.75%17.03%14.63%2.79%
Upgrade
Return on Capital (ROIC)
26.59%26.59%30.09%33.68%29.33%6.09%
Upgrade
Return on Capital Employed (ROCE)
37.50%37.50%40.70%45.30%39.50%8.80%
Upgrade
Earnings Yield
2.29%2.26%1.49%2.20%1.06%0.66%
Upgrade
FCF Yield
1.31%1.30%0.86%1.25%0.76%0.56%
Upgrade
Dividend Yield
1.65%1.10%0.71%0.98%0.46%0.29%
Upgrade
Payout Ratio
66.93%66.92%32.40%39.77%36.39%21.39%
Upgrade
Total Shareholder Return
1.65%1.10%0.71%0.98%0.46%0.29%
Upgrade
Updated Feb 11,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.